Laundry room plumbing tips

You don't need to be a plumbing to understand a little about your washing machine. This convenient home appliance makes our lives a lot easier, it's important that we treat it well so it stays in great condition for years to come. A simple method to keep your machine running smoothly is to inspect its hose pipes. If you observe signs of wear, consider replacing old rubber hose pipes with ones made from braided stainless-steel. These more recent materials will last longer and are much less most likely to split or leak. In order to find something wrong, keep an eye on your washing machine water line. If you see this line considerably altering you may have a blockage or other problem within your washer. A common problem that occurs with a washer is that the drain line will obstruct with hair and other particles from the laundry. Make sure you have a strainer on your washing machine tube to stay out these potentially problematic products. Another blockage that may happen is within the pipelines. Water heater maintenance

Your water heater is the other major device in the basement. This practical device controls the temperature of the water in all of your sinks, tubs and showers. In order to keep your bathing and dishwashing practices comfy and not too hot, you'll need to periodically do some upkeep on your hot water heater. To keep yours running and in great condition, you'll need to flush the tank and inspect the anode rod each year..

To flush your tank, initially switch off the electrical power and water to the heater. Then wait several hours for it to cool. When you can touch the tank and is no longer warm, utilize a garden hose pipe and pump to drain it. The water originating from the tank needs to be put into a container so you can see exactly what color it is. Dark water means there is a great deal of mineral buildup. This can rust your tank and cause problems with the temperature level. Refill the tank with clean water then repeat this draining process up until the water is clear. Remove your tube and pump and turn on both the water and electrical power so your water heater can return to its normal functioning.
